From 7a0dd3ebdf5113a4139720709b4c3a15190c377e Mon Sep 17 00:00:00 2001 From: Florian Festi Date: Wed, 21 Dec 2022 22:36:52 +0100 Subject: [PATCH] flangedWall: Fix placement of finger holes for walls with other width than t --- boxes/__init__.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/boxes/__init__.py b/boxes/__init__.py index 5316877..baeda35 100755 --- a/boxes/__init__.py +++ b/boxes/__init__.py @@ -2448,7 +2448,7 @@ class Boxes: self.cc(callback, i, x=-rl) if flanges[i]: if edges[i] is self.edges["F"] or edges[i] is self.edges["h"]: - self.fingerHolesAt(flanges[i-1]+t-rl, 0.5*t+flanges[i], l, + self.fingerHolesAt(flanges[i-1]+edges[i-1].endwidth()-rl, 0.5*t+flanges[i], l, angle=0) self.edge(l+flanges[i-1]+flanges[i+1]+edges[i-1].endwidth()+edges[i+1].startwidth()-rl-rr) else: